As a Maintenance Staff Member, you’ll be responsible for ensuring that all mechanical systems and equipment are operational and properly maintained and all common areas are maintained in a clean, aesthetically appealing, and disinfected condition.

Responsibilities
- Routinely walk floors including roof checking for problems and lights out; report back to supervisors.
- Ensure all safety precautions are followed while performing work.
- Maintain working relationship with building staff.
- Paint all common areas and perform touch-ups as required; inspect areas needing paint and advise manager.
- Complete daily work orders as scheduled.
- Maintain assigned equipment in good working condition.
- Perform casual labor such as lifting/moving heavy items as directed by supervisors, following appropriate safety procedures.
- Perform minor maintenance replacement and repairs in carpentry, electrical work, HVAC, plumbing, mechanical, painting, flooring, and other building repairs through daily scheduled work orders.
- Follow safety procedures and maintain a safe work environment.
- Perform maintenance replacement and repair in areas of carpentry, electrical work, plumbing, mechanical, painting, flooring, and other minor building repairs as long as a permit is not required.
- Properly utilize new equipment and follow safety procedures prior to using this equipment.
Requirements
- High school diploma or equivalency preferred.
- Two years of general experience in building trades, repair and replacement maintenance, or handyman work.
- Effective written and verbal communication skills.
- Strong customer service, communication, and interpersonal skills.
- Multiple language fluency is desirable.
- Maintain a valid Florida driver’s license.
Physical Requirements
- Ability to lift up to 50 lbs following appropriate safety procedures.
- Work in an upright standing position for long periods of time; be able to reach overhead; have full range of mobility in upper and lower body.
- Work in various positions, including but not limited to stooping, standing, bending over, sitting, kneeling, squatting, and climbing stairs for extended periods of time.
- Navigate the property/building quickly and easily as required to meet job functions.
- Climb ladders and work at heights above ground level (maximum 14 ft on A-frames and 21 ft on extension ladders).
- Work in different environmental conditions (e.g., heat, cold, wind, rain, humidity).
- Repeat various motions with the wrists, hands, and fingers.
- Lift, pull, and push materials and equipment up to 50 lbs occasionally to complete assigned job tasks.
- Communicate, receive, and exchange ideas and information by means of spoken and written word.
